WHAT better way could there be to bring the half-term to a climax than spending Saturday afternoon in the company of The Chuckle Brothers at York Barbican?
Armed with a wizard idea for their new show, the South Yorkshire duo are on tour in The Chuckles Of Oz, bringing Dorothy, the Tin Man, the Cowardly Lion and the Scarecrow to York this coming weekend.
Rotherham brothers Barry and Paul will play the wizards in a new version of The Wizard Of Oz that will give a “unique glimpse of the Emerald City in a packed family fun show brimming with laugh-out-loud comedy”.
